High-Resolution Mapping of Fine Particulate Matter in Teltow – Berlin: Mobile and Stationary Measurements for Better Air Quality

High-Resolution Mapping of Fine Particulate Matter in Teltow – Berlin: Mobile and Stationary Measurements for Better Air Quality

The publication “High-Spatial Resolution Maps of PM2.5 Using Mobile Sensors on Buses: A Case Study of Teltow City, Germany, in the Suburb of Berlin, 2023” was published on December 15, 2024, in the journal Atmosphere. NovelSense to participate in KoFeMo Project

Starting July 2024 NovelSense is partner in the KoFeMo – mFUND research project. In urban areas, air purity is playing an increasingly important role. Motor vehicles, with their emissions from exhaust, brakes, and tires, are the main contributors to particulate matter pollution.
